← Back to Blog

SEO Fundamentals: A Beginner's Guide

Learn the basics of search engine optimization and how to improve your website's visibility in search results.

Search Engine Optimization (SEO) is the practice of improving your website so it ranks higher in search engine results pages (SERPs). When done correctly, SEO drives organic traffic to your site, increases visibility, and helps potential customers find you.

Why SEO Matters

Over 90% of online experiences begin with a search engine. If your website doesn't appear in search results, you're missing out on a massive opportunity to reach your audience. SEO helps you:

  • Increase organic traffic
  • Build brand awareness
  • Generate leads and sales
  • Compete with larger competitors
  • Establish authority in your industry

On-Page SEO: Optimizing Your Content

On-page SEO involves optimizing elements directly on your website:

Title Tags: The clickable headline in search results. Keep it under 60 characters and include your target keyword.

Meta Descriptions: The snippet below the title. Write compelling copy under 160 characters that encourages clicks.

Header Tags (H1, H2, H3): Structure your content with clear headings. Use H1 once per page for your main topic.

Image Alt Text: Describe images for accessibility and search engines. Include relevant keywords naturally.

URL Structure: Keep URLs short, descriptive, and include keywords when possible (e.g., /blog/seo-fundamentals).

Keyword Research

Keywords are the terms people type into search engines. Effective SEO starts with understanding what your audience is searching for.

Types of Keywords:

  • Short-tail: Broad terms like "web design" (high competition)
  • Long-tail: Specific phrases like "affordable web design for small business" (lower competition, higher intent)
  • Local: Geographic terms like "web design in [your city]"

Use tools like Google Keyword Planner, Ahrefs, or Ubersuggest to find keywords relevant to your business.

Technical SEO: The Foundation

Technical SEO ensures search engines can crawl and index your site:

  • Site Speed: Fast-loading pages rank better. Optimize images, use caching, and minimize code.
  • Mobile Responsiveness: Google prioritizes mobile-friendly sites. Ensure your site works perfectly on all devices.
  • SSL Certificate: HTTPS is required for security and ranking. Always use secure connections.
  • XML Sitemap: Helps search engines understand your site structure.
  • Robots.txt: Tells search engines which pages to crawl or ignore.

Content Quality: The King

High-quality, valuable content is the cornerstone of SEO success. Search engines reward content that:

  • Answers user questions thoroughly
  • Is original and well-written
  • Provides value to readers
  • Is regularly updated
  • Uses keywords naturally (not stuffed)

Off-Page SEO: Building Authority

Off-page SEO involves factors outside your website:

Backlinks: Links from other reputable websites signal authority. Focus on quality over quantity.

Social Signals: While not a direct ranking factor, social shares can increase visibility and traffic.

Local Citations: Consistent business information across directories helps local SEO.

Measuring SEO Success

Track your progress with:

  • Google Search Console: See which keywords bring traffic
  • Google Analytics: Monitor organic traffic, bounce rates, and conversions
  • Rank tracking tools: Monitor keyword positions

Getting Started

SEO is a long-term strategy that requires patience and consistency. Start with the basics:

  1. Optimize your existing pages with proper titles and descriptions
  2. Create valuable, keyword-focused content regularly
  3. Ensure your site is fast and mobile-friendly
  4. Build quality backlinks through partnerships and content
  5. Monitor and adjust based on data

Need help with your SEO strategy? SN Web Design offers comprehensive SEO audits and optimization services to help your site rank higher.